    Merrill Kelly Leads #1 Baseball To 6-0 Victory Over Houston

    TEMPE, Ariz. - Merrill Kelly threw seven shutout innings and Zach Wilson drove in five as the No. 1 Arizona State University baseball team defeated Houston 6-0 on Saturday at Winkles Field-Packard Stadium at Brock Ballpark. A crowd of 3,820 saw the Sun Devils improve to 19-0 on the season with the win.

    Kelly allowed just two hits and two walks while striking out eight to improve to 5-0 in his first five starts of the season. Mitchell Lambson and Jordan Swagerty each pitched scoreless innings out of the bullpen to finish off the victory.

    Wilson was the star at the plate, going 3-for-4 with a home run and five RBI to lead the Sun Devil offense. Johnny Ruettiger also had three hits in the victory.

    The Sun Devils got on the board early, as Zack MacPhee and Kole Calhoun both drew walks and Riccio Torrez followed with an RBI double over the head of the Houston third baseman.

    In the third, Calhoun led off with a single and Riccio Torrez was hit by a pitch, and two batters later, Wilson hit a three-run homer to center to put ASU in front 4-0. An inning later, Wilson again provided the spark at the plate, driving in both Calhoun and Matt Newman on a two-out double down the left field line.

    That was more than enough offense for Kelly and the bullpen, as the Cougars had just three men reach base over the final seven innings.

    The Sun Devils will conclude their three-game series with Houston on Sunday, with first pitch scheduled for 12:30 p.m. at Winkles Field-Packard Stadium at Brock Ballpark.
